A new vision on strong leadership is not a luxury, but a necessity.
All over the world the economic crisis and other developments in society are being seen as an indication that patterns of thinking and strategies from the industrial era do not suffice any longer. A fundamentally different approach to thinking and acting is needed, and the coming decade is crucial in this development.
New concepts of leadership are needed to ensure a dynamic shift to a progressive knowledge economy with a focus on the human factor.
The new generation of young and inspiring leaders needs to be equipped for this development. A fundamental discussion and exploration of rising talents is necessary at the dawn of new concepts of leadership that are linked to the knowledge economy.
This course on leadership for sustainable innovation offers students in the final phase of their studies and young professional an opportunity to engage in this discussion.
The course welcomes strong personalities, future leaders, talented and creative thinkers who are interested in discussing relevant patterns for new strategies and approaches. The course offers the start of an exploration of realistic concepts of leadership towards a strengthened knowledge economy and an involved society with a focus on people’s expectations (planet, people and profit).
Transfer of knowledge, dialogue and communicative development in a variety of activities are the basis of this course.
